HMC470A

RECOMMENDED FOR NEW DESIGNS

0.1 GHz to 3 GHz,1 dB LSB, 5-Bit, GaAs Digital Attenuator

 

Viewing:

Overview

  • Attenuation range: 1 dB LSB steps to 31 dB
  • Insertion loss: 1.7 dB typical at 3 GHz
  • Excellent attenuation accuracy: 0.3 dB typical
  • High Input linearity
    • 0.1dB compression (P0.1dB): 27 dBm typical
    • Third-order intercept (IP3): 48 dBm typical
  • High power handling: 27 dBm
  • Low phase shift: 27° at 3 GHz
  • Single-supply operation: 3 V to 5 V
  • CMOS-/TTL-compatible parallel control
  • 16-lead, 3 mm × 3 mm LFCSP package

The HMC470A is a 5-bit digital attenuator with a 31 dB attenuation control range in 1 dB steps.

The HMC470A offers excellent attenuation accuracy and high input linearity over the specified frequency range from 100 MHz to 3 GHz. However, this digital attenuator features ACG pins for external ac grounding capacitors to extend the operation below 100 MHz.

The HMC470A operates with a single positive supply voltage from 3 V to 5 V and provides CMOS-/TTL-compatible parallel control interface by incorporating an on-chip driver. The HMC470A comes in a RoHS compliant, compact, 3 mm × 3 mm LFCSP package.

Applications

  • Cellular infrastructure
  • Microwave radios and very small aperture terminals (VSATs)
  • Test equipment and sensors
  • IF and RF designs

ADIsimRF

ADIsimRF is an easy-to-use RF signal chain calculator. Cascaded gain, noise, distortion and power consumption can be calculated, plotted and exported for signal chains with up to 50 stages. ADIsimRF also includes an extensive data base of device models for ADI’s RF and mixed signal components.
